WDNA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2021 in Review
7 of the 6,517 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in WisdomTree BioRevolution Fund (WDNA) for Q4 2021, worth a combined $1.1M — up 227% from $336K a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 4 funds opened new WDNA posit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 4 holders — while 2 added to existing stakes and 0 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Flow Traders U.S., adding an estimated $498K.
